Facilities Officer

The School is seeking an enthusiastic and dynamic Facilities Officer to join our School. 

This all-rounder will be involved in the ongoing maintenance of the School’s buildings and the upkeep of the extensive grounds and gardens. 

This is an ongoing, full time position and involves work during term time and school holidays, with 4 weeks leave a year. 

Daily hours are 7.00am to 3.00pm, however some flexibility is required. Start date to be negotiated with the successful candidate, to commence as soon as possible.

Previous school facilities and maintenance experience would be an advantage

Key Responsibilities

  • Prune plants, fertilise gardens and lawns, weed garden beds and mow lawns. 
  • Ensure that the grounds are well maintained and free of debris and litter. 
  • Maintain the automatic water reticulation system including the bores and basic reticulation repairs.
  • Carry out minor repairs and maintenance to School buildings.
  • Install, move, store and relocate furniture and equipment as required.
  • Assist with the management of waste disposal for the School.
  • Ensure security, smoke detector alarms and other automated systems (such as air conditioning and lighting) are effectively maintained and operated.
  • Assist in setting up and clearing up for special School events.

About the Anglican Schools Commission

Founded in 1985, the Core Purpose of the Anglican Schools Commission (Inc.) (ASC) is to establish and support low fee Anglican systemic schools which provide a high quality, inclusive, caring Christian education.

Growing from modest beginnings with the opening of St Mark's Anglican Community School in 1986 in Perth's northern beaches suburb of Hillary’s, there are now approximately 14,000 students attending fourteen ASC schools in Western Australia, New South Wales and Victoria. We have schools in Perth, Mandurah, Busselton and Esperance in Western Australia; in Albury in New South Wales; and in Wangaratta and Cobram in Victoria.

Our international arm, ASC International is dedicated to servicing international students wishing to study in our schools. ASC International offers short term and long term programs, as well as study tours at all 14 ASC schools.
